[release-branch.go1.17] cmd/compile: do not use special literal assignment if LHS is address-taken

A composite literal assignment

x = T{field: v}

may be compiled to

x = T{}
x.field = v

We already do not use this form is RHS uses LHS. If LHS is
address-taken, RHS may uses LHS implicitly, e.g.

v = &x.field
x = T{field: *v}

The lowering above would change the value of RHS (*v).

Updates #52953.
Fixes #52960.

// Issue 52953: miscompilation for composite literal assignment
// when LHS is address-taken.
package main
type T struct {
Field1 bool
}
func main() {
var ret T
ret.Field1 = true
var v *bool = &ret.Field1
ret = T{Field1: *v}
check(ret.Field1)
}
//go:noinline
func check(b bool) {
if !b {
panic("FAIL")
}
}
